This Is Where Traders Get Trapped ‼️
Most traders think they lose because they entered the wrong direction.
But many times, the real problem is where they entered.
The market often creates a setup that looks perfect to the majority of traders. Price approaches an obvious high or low, breaks it with a strong candle, and suddenly everyone thinks the move has started.
That’s where the trap begins.
The Breakout Trap
Imagine price has been respecting a clear resistance level for several hours.
Everyone can see the same high.
Buy orders are waiting above it, while short sellers have their stop losses there.
Then price suddenly pushes above the high.
Retail traders see the breakout and enter long, expecting continuation.
But instead of continuing, price quickly reverses back below the level.
What happened?
The market may have simply taken the buy-side liquidity above that high.
The breakout wasn’t necessarily confirmation.
It was the liquidity sweep.
Don’t Chase the First Move
This is one of the biggest differences between an emotional trader and a patient trader.
An emotional trader sees:
Breakout → Entry → Hope
A patient trader looks for:
Liquidity Sweep → MSS → Retracement → Entry
After liquidity is taken, wait for a Market Structure Shift (MSS).
The MSS can provide evidence that the short-term direction has changed.
Then look for your execution area, such as an Order Block (OB), Fair Value Gap (FVG), or 0.71 Fibonacci area, depending on your strategy.
You don’t need to predict the reversal.
You need to wait for the market to show it.
Where Most Traders Get Trapped
There are usually three emotions behind these entries:
FOMO:
“Price is moving without me. I need to enter now.”
Confirmation Bias:
“The candle is huge, so the breakout must be real.”
Impatience:
“I can’t wait for another confirmation.”
These emotions push traders into the market at the exact moment when liquidity is being collected.
And once the reversal starts, they become the liquidity for someone else’s trade.
A Better Way to Read the Chart
Before entering, ask yourself:
Where is the liquidity?
Look for obvious equal highs, equal lows, previous highs/lows and areas where many traders are likely placing stops.
Then wait for the sequence:
Liquidity → Sweep → MSS → OB/FVG → Entry → Target Liquidity
This doesn’t guarantee a winning trade.
But it gives you a structured process instead of blindly chasing candles.
Remember This
The breakout is not always the opportunity. Sometimes, the breakout IS the trap.
You don’t get paid for entering first.
You get paid for entering when your setup is confirmed.
No Shift = No Trade.
Be patient. Let the market take liquidity first.
Then let the market prove your idea.
